The video tutorial guides viewers through solving a digital exam question using a TI Inspire calculator. It involves finding the equation of a line given two points. The process includes setting up a new document, entering coordinates, and testing various functions to identify the correct equation that passes through the given points. The correct answer is determined to be option D.
